Episode 27: The Silent Escape

Under the shimmering glow of the moon, Tanji and Zhai stood in the grove, holding the precious Flower Key. The group of academy students, still reeling from their earlier encounter, eyed them with a mix of fear and confusion.

Tanji looked at them calmly, his fingers tracing the intricate flower patterns on the golden key. "This is where we part ways," he said softly, his voice carrying an edge of authority.

Zhai stepped forward, grinning mischievously. "But first, a little something to ensure you all get a good rest."

With a flick of his wrist, Zhai conjured a spell, a wave of shimmering golden light spreading across the grove. The students tried to resist, but the spell was too strong. One by one, they yawned, their eyes fluttering shut as they fell into a deep, enchanted sleep.

Zhai crouched beside one of the students and mockingly whispered, "Goodnight, sweet dreams." He stood up, brushing his hands together with satisfaction.

Tanji smirked, slipping the key into his pocket. "Efficient, as always, Zhai. Let's go before anyone else stumbles upon us."

---

As they walked through the academy's quiet paths, Zhai suddenly stretched his arms above his head, letting out an exaggerated sigh.

"Master," he began, "I'm tired of all this running around. The academy, the spells, the missions—don't you think we deserve a break?"

Tanji raised an eyebrow, glancing at him. "A break? We're in the middle of something important, Zhai. The Flower Key is just the beginning."

Zhai rolled his eyes. "I know, I know. The whole five-element thing, the red pearl, the destiny, blah blah blah. But come on, Master. Even you need to rest. Let's head to Heaven. Just for a bit. A big, long break where no one bothers us."

Tanji chuckled softly. "You're always full of ideas, aren't you? And what would you do in Heaven, exactly?"

Zhai grinned, his eyes lighting up. "I'd eat the best food, relax in the golden gardens, maybe even visit the Celestial Springs. Oh, and definitely avoid anyone asking me to read ancient texts!"

Tanji shook his head, amused. "Fine. We'll take a short break. But remember, Zhai, this is temporary. The real journey is just beginning."

Zhai pumped his fist in the air, his excitement barely contained. "Yes! You won't regret this, Master."

---

The two disappeared into the shadows, leaving the academy behind as they made their way toward Heaven.

But even as Zhai dreamed of relaxation and indulgence, Tanji's mind was already calculating their next move. The Flower Key was just one piece of the puzzle, and he knew the challenges ahead would only grow more dangerous.

For now, though, a brief moment of peace

awaited them—before the storm resumed.
